The following panels are considered out of date or have been involved in an electrical panel recall: FPE panels were a popular electrical panel and were widely used starting in the 1950s through 1990. Experts say that Zinsco panels produced during this time would not receive today's UL listing. Going Solar with SMUD: What You Need to Know - SolarReviews In general, when theres a shortage of a specific type of transformer, or other equipment, SMUD will issue available transformers and equipment once the customers project is electrically ready to serve load. Once the final paperwork is approved, we typically send payment within 2 weeks of the approval date. Once SMUD receives the electrical inspection from your local agency, a SMUD service crew will be assigned to complete installation of SMUD's meter, connect or install service wire, and energize your service. That recall specifically focused on Challenger panels with 15- and 20- ampere circuit breakers made between February and April of 1988 that have a mechanical component that can detach leading to overheating, melting, and fire.
